The DOT would like to provide Contractors an easier way to view letting plans in an effort to increase awareness of DOT projects. Currently, contractors must purchase plans to determine if they wish to bid on a particular project. Because one set of plans can cost several hundred dollars, smaller contractors may not be willing to make this investment. By providing plans electronically free or at a low costs, we anticipate increased exposure which should help increase competition and, therefore, lower construction cost. The purpose of this CPM project is to research the different possibilities for providing plans on the Internet and to determine the need for this service.Collections
